The reduced sputtering yield (Y-n(R)) of materials induced by fist neutron
is presented. Based on the experimental Y-n(R) results for (n, 2n), (n, p),
(n, alpha) and (n, np) reactions, the value of Y-n(R) for (n, non-elastic)
reaction is deduced by using data of cross sections in JENDL-3.2 and ENDF/
B-VI. The value of Y-n(R) for (n, n) reaction is predicted by relation betw
een Y-n(R) and the mean projected ranges of recoil nuclides. Combining both
Y-n(R) for (n, n) and (n, non-elastic) reactions, the total Y-n(R) is obta
ined. Systematics of Y-n(R) for (n, non-elastic), (n, n) and (n, total) rea
ctions have been demonstrated.
